EV Charging Infrastructure refers to the network of stations, equipment, and systems that provide electric vehicle (EV) owners with the means to charge their vehicles. This infrastructure encompasses various types of charging points, including residential home chargers, public charging stations, and fast-charging solutions located in strategic areas such as highways, shopping centers, and urban locations. The charging infrastructure is crucial for enabling the widespread adoption of electric vehicles by ensuring that drivers have accessible, reliable, and efficient charging options. It includes not only the physical charging units but also the necessary electrical supply, connectivity for payment and usage tracking, and integration with energy management systems. Overall, a comprehensive EV charging infrastructure supports sustainability goals by promoting the use of electric vehicles and reducing reliance on fossil fuels.
